nginx代理数据库端口怎么设置

要将nginx代理数据库端口,需要在nginx的配置文件中设置一个代理服务器的location块。以下是一个示例配置:server {listen 80;server_name example.com;location / {proxy_pass http://localhost:3306; # 将数据库端口代理到3306端口proxy_set_header Host $host;proxy_s

要将nginx代理数据库端口,需要在nginx的配置文件中设置一个代理服务器的location块。以下是一个示例配置:

server {
    listen 80;
    server_name example.com;

    location / {
        proxy_pass http://localhost:3306; # 将数据库端口代理到3306端口
        proxy_set_header Host $host;
        proxy_set_header X-Real-IP $remote_addr;
        proxy_set_header X-Forwarded-For $proxy_add_x_forwarded_for;
        proxy_set_header X-Forwarded-Proto $scheme;
    }
}

在上面的示例中,我们使用proxy_pass指令将数据库端口代理到本地的3306端口。如果数据库端口是在另一台服务器上,则需要将localhost替换为对应的IP地址或域名。

记得重启nginx服务以使配置生效。

版权声明:本文内容由互联网用户自发贡献,该文观点仅代表作者本人。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如发现本站有涉嫌抄袭侵权/违法违规的内容,请发送邮件至 55@qq.com 举报,一经查实,本站将立刻删除。转转请注明出处:https://www.szhjjp.com/n/977887.html

(0)
派派
上一篇 2024-04-07
下一篇 2024-04-07

相关推荐

  • DLP在保护客户个人信息中有什么作用

    DLP(Data Loss Prevention)是一种数据丢失预防技术,可以帮助企业防止敏感数据泄露和意外外泄。在保护客户个人信息方面,DLP可以发挥以下作用:监控和发现敏感数据:DLP系统可以监控企业网络中的数据流量,识别和发现敏感个人信息,如身份证号码、信用卡信息等。阻止数据泄露:一旦发现有人试图传输或存储敏感信息,DLP系统可以立即采取措施,阻止数据泄露,包括禁止复制、粘贴、打印等操作。加

    2024-05-08
    0
  • spark如何获取当前时间戳

    在Spark中,可以使用Scala语言的System.currentTimeMillis()方法来获取当前时间戳。具体代码如下:val currentTimeMillis = System.currentTimeMillis()println(“Current timestamp: ” + currentTimeMillis)在Spark中也可以使用java.sql.Timestamp类来获取

    2024-04-12
    0
  • 网页如何加背景音乐(在网页中添加背景音乐)

    1、首先把所选需要的音乐文件放到网页同一个文件。2、用Adobe Dreamweaver CS6软件打开网页,在网页设计栏鼠标指向任意一个你想放置的音乐背景位置,然后在菜单栏选 插入/媒体(M)/插件(P),按照路径选择你需要设置背景音乐的MP3文件双击鼠标左键。

    2022-05-06
    0
  • debian静态ip开机未生效怎么解决

    如果在Debian上设置了静态IP地址但开机后未生效,可能是由于网络管理服务没有正确配置导致的。您可以尝试以下解决方法:检查网络配置文件:打开 /etc/network/interfaces 文件,确保正确配置了静态IP地址信息。例如:auto eth0iface eth0 inet staticaddress 192.168.1.100netmask 255.255.255.0gateway

    2024-03-22
    0
  • android下拉列表控件的作用是什么

    Android下拉列表控件(Spinner)是一种用户界面控件,通常用于在用户选择一项或多项选项时提供一个下拉列表供用户选择。它可以用来展示一组选项,用户可以通过点击下拉列表来选择其中的一项。Android下拉列表控件的作用包括:提供用户友好的交互方式:用户可以通过下拉列表来选择不同的选项,而不需要输入文本或进行其他复杂的操作。节省空间:由于下拉列表是一个紧凑的控件,可以展示多个选项但占用很少

    2024-02-20
    0
  • mysql分割数据的方式有哪些

    在MySQL中,可以使用以下几种方式来分割数据:分区表:通过在表的创建时定义分区规则,将数据存储在不同的分区中。常见的分区方式包括按范围、按列表、按哈希等方式分区。分表:将一个大表按某个规则拆分成多个小表,每个小表存储部分数据。通常可以按时间、按业务或者按数据量等方式进行分表。分库:将一个数据库中的表按某个规则进行拆分,存储到多个数据库中。通常可以按业务、按地域等方式进行分库。水平分割:将数据按行

    2024-03-02
    0

发表回复

登录后才能评论